Job description
Join a cutting-edge engineering team as a Senior Software Engineer developing autonomous systems for the next generation of marine and defence technology. This is a fantastic opportunity for an experienced Software Engineer to take a leading role in designing, developing, and delivering advanced software solutions that operate in challenging real-world environments.
As a Senior Software Engineer, you’ll work across the full software lifecycle, from concept and design through to integration, testing and delivery, as part of a multidisciplinary engineering team shaping the future of maritime autonomy.
What you’ll be doing as a Senior Software Engineer
Designing and developing software for advanced autonomous systems Supporting integration and delivery activities across complex engineering projects Collaborating with hardware, systems and domain experts throughout the development lifecycle Engaging directly with end users to refine functionality and performance Taking a lead role in development discussions and cross-team collaboration What you’ll bring as a Senior Software Engineer
Requirements
Proven experience in software design and delivery A degree (or equivalent experience) in Software Engineering, Computer Science, or a related discipline Knowledge of autonomous system architectures and the marine or defence domain Strong understanding of software engineering processes, tools, and lifecycles Experience working in multi-disciplinary engineering environments Technical skills required by the Senior Software Engineer
Essential:
Java development Java build systems (e.g. Maven) Experience with the Atlassian toolset (Jira, Confluence, Bitbucket) Knowledge of ISO 9001 quality principlesDesirable:
HMI / UI development (e.g. JavaFX) GIS development Communication and control system interfaces Git version control UML design Why apply?
Benefits & conditions
Hybrid and flexible working options (full-time, part-time or condensed hours) Excellent professional development and progression opportunities Collaborative and innovative engineering culture Competitive salary, pension and benefits Security Clearance: Applicants must be eligible to obtain UK Security Clearance (SC).
